    Hello,

    The comments on our blog stopped syncing on September 24 2014. No settings were changed that we know of; but the people who used to maintain this site left at that time, so a list of how to troubleshoot that to make sure that syncing is still enabled, would be welcome.

    Discussions on newer posts get created fine. People are able to comment on them. Then, once a post is about 2 weeks old…the discussions will no longer load. Discussions (and their comments) load on older posts just fine. But, again, no settings were changed, so we’re not sure why this odd, random gap in ability to load Disqus discussions.

    We found why the Disqus comments stopped showing – the previous folks had checked the WordPress box disallowing comments after 14 days rather than changing the settings in Disqus itself – but we’re still not sure why the automatic syncing also stopped on that day.

    For anyone else coming to look for the solution:
    If you have the Disqus plugin installed, do not use the in-dash WordPress settings to control how long comments may remain open. Use the Disqus-native admin settings for that.

    In WordPress, go to
    Dashboard > Settings > Discussion
    Look under Other Comment Settings
    Make sure to UNCHECK the option
    “Automatically close comments on articles older than ___ days.”

    Then your Disqus comments will display on all your WP articles.
